Overview: what glioma means
Glioma is a tumor that starts in glial cells, the supporting cells of the brain and spinal cord. These cells help protect nerve cells, maintain the environment around them, and support normal brain function. When a glioma forms, the cells grow in an abnormal and uncontrolled way.
The term glioma covers a group of tumors rather than one single diagnosis. Some gliomas grow slowly and may be monitored for a time, while others are more aggressive and need prompt treatment. Doctors classify gliomas by the type of cell they most resemble, such as astrocytoma, oligodendroglioma, or ependymoma, and by grade, which reflects how abnormal the cells look and how likely the tumor is to grow quickly.
Modern care also looks beyond the microscope. Today, tumor tissue is often tested for molecular features, such as IDH mutation status and other markers, because these findings can influence the diagnosis, expected behavior, and treatment plan. This more precise approach helps specialists tailor care to the individual rather than relying only on the tumor’s appearance.
Symptoms and how glioma can present
Glioma symptoms vary because they depend mainly on where the tumor is located, how large it is, and how quickly it grows. Some people develop symptoms gradually over weeks or months, while others notice a more sudden change. In a few cases, a glioma is found incidentally during brain imaging done for another reason.
Possible symptoms include persistent headaches, seizures, nausea, vomiting, changes in memory or concentration, personality or behavior changes, weakness on one side of the body, balance problems, speech difficulty, or vision changes. A tumor near the spinal cord may cause back pain, weakness, numbness, or bowel and bladder problems.
These symptoms do not always mean a person has a brain tumor. Many common conditions, including migraines, inner ear problems, stroke, infections, or medication effects, can cause similar complaints. Still, new, unexplained, or progressive neurological symptoms should be assessed by a qualified doctor so that the cause can be identified and managed appropriately.

Types, causes, and risk factors
Gliomas are commonly grouped by their cell type and grade. Astrocytomas arise from astrocyte-like cells and include a range from lower-grade tumors to more aggressive forms. Oligodendrogliomas tend to have specific molecular changes that help define them, while ependymomas arise from cells lining fluid-filled spaces in the brain or central canal of the spinal cord. A specialist may also discuss whether the tumor is diffuse, meaning it spreads into nearby tissue, or more localized.
In most people, there is no single clear cause of glioma. These tumors are usually not linked to anything a person did or did not do. Researchers believe gliomas develop through changes in the DNA of glial cells that allow them to keep dividing, but why this happens is often unknown.
Some factors can increase risk, although they do not mean a person will definitely develop a glioma. These include increasing age for some glioma types, certain rare inherited syndromes, and previous exposure to ionizing radiation to the head. Routine use of phones, ordinary headaches, or stress are not established causes of glioma. If there is a strong family history of brain tumors or a known genetic condition, a doctor may consider genetic counseling as part of the evaluation.
How glioma is diagnosed today
Diagnosis usually begins with a neurological examination and brain imaging. Magnetic resonance imaging is often the main test because it provides detailed pictures of the brain and can show the tumor’s size, location, and relationship to nearby structures. In some situations, advanced imaging techniques may help estimate how active the tumor is or assist with surgical planning. When appropriate, doctors may evaluate a suspected brain tumor in a multidisciplinary setting that includes neurology, neuroradiology, neurosurgery, pathology, and oncology.
Imaging alone usually cannot provide the full diagnosis. A tissue sample is often needed, either through biopsy or during surgery, so that a pathologist can examine the tumor under a microscope. This confirms the tumor type and grade and helps distinguish glioma from other conditions that can mimic it on scans.
Molecular testing has become a central part of diagnosis. Specialists may test for markers such as IDH mutation, 1p/19q codeletion, MGMT promoter methylation, and other genetic alterations, depending on the tumor type. These results can clarify the diagnosis and help predict how the tumor may behave and which treatments are more likely to be helpful. Blood tests are not enough to diagnose glioma, but they may be used to assess overall health before treatment.
Modern treatment approaches
Treatment for glioma is individualized. The plan depends on the tumor type, grade, location, size, symptoms, molecular findings, and the person’s age and general health. The main goals are to remove or control the tumor as safely as possible, relieve symptoms, preserve neurological function, and support quality of life.
Surgery is often the first step when it can be done safely. An operation may be performed to obtain tissue for diagnosis, reduce pressure in the brain, improve symptoms, and remove as much of the tumor as possible without harming critical brain areas. In selected cases, this may involve brain tumor surgery planned with advanced imaging and mapping techniques. If a tumor is located in a highly sensitive area or is not safely removable, a stereotactic biopsy may be used to obtain tissue with less disruption.
Radiation therapy is commonly used after surgery or biopsy, especially for higher-grade gliomas or tumors that cannot be completely removed. It uses carefully planned beams to target tumor cells while limiting exposure to surrounding tissue. Some patients also receive radiation therapy together with or followed by chemotherapy, depending on the tumor’s features.
Drug treatment may include chemotherapy or other systemic therapies chosen according to the glioma subtype and molecular profile. For some tumors, specialists may discuss medical oncology care that includes chemotherapy, symptom control medications, and supportive management. In lower-grade gliomas, careful observation after surgery may sometimes be appropriate, while more aggressive tumors usually need combination treatment. Rehabilitation, seizure control, and steroid treatment to reduce swelling may also be important parts of care.
Outlook and living with glioma
The outlook for glioma varies widely. Some low-grade gliomas can remain stable for years, while higher-grade gliomas may grow more quickly and need intensive treatment. Doctors estimate outlook by considering many factors together, including age, neurological function, tumor grade, how much tumor could be removed, and molecular characteristics identified on pathology testing.
It is often helpful to think of prognosis as a range rather than a fixed prediction. Two people with tumors in the same general category may still have different experiences because of tumor biology, treatment response, and overall health. Follow-up imaging is an important part of care because it helps doctors assess treatment response and monitor for recurrence or progression.
Living with glioma can affect physical, emotional, and cognitive well-being. Fatigue, changes in concentration, mood shifts, and anxiety about scans or symptoms are common concerns. Supportive care may include neuro-rehabilitation, counseling, nutrition guidance, speech or occupational therapy, and palliative care focused on symptom relief at any stage of illness. Self-care, monitoring, and prevention
There is no known way to prevent most gliomas. Because the cause is usually not related to a modifiable lifestyle factor, people should not blame themselves for the diagnosis. Instead, practical self-care focuses on following treatment recommendations, managing symptoms, and protecting overall health during and after therapy.
Helpful steps may include taking medicines exactly as prescribed, especially anti-seizure drugs or steroids if they are part of the plan; attending scheduled MRI scans and follow-up visits; getting enough rest; and staying as physically active as a doctor advises. People who have had seizures may need guidance about driving, working at heights, or swimming alone. Family members can often help by noticing changes in memory, speech, or behavior that the patient may not recognize.
General health measures can support recovery and resilience. These include balanced nutrition, hydration, avoiding tobacco, limiting alcohol if advised by the medical team, and asking about rehabilitation services when strength, speech, or thinking are affected. It is also reasonable to discuss fertility preservation, return to work, or school accommodations when treatment planning begins.
When to seek medical care
Medical evaluation is important for any new or worsening neurological symptom. A person should arrange prompt medical care for persistent headaches that are unusual for them, a first seizure, unexplained weakness, confusion, difficulty speaking, vision changes, or problems with balance. Even when the cause is not a glioma, these symptoms deserve careful assessment.
Urgent care is needed for sudden severe headache, loss of consciousness, repeated vomiting, a seizure that does not stop, rapidly worsening weakness, or sudden major changes in speech or awareness. These symptoms can have several causes, including stroke or bleeding, and should not be ignored.
After a glioma diagnosis, patients should contact their care team if they develop new seizures, worsening headaches, increasing drowsiness, signs of infection, medication side effects, or any significant change in daily function. Early communication can help manage problems before they become more disruptive.
Frequently asked questions
Is glioma always cancer?
Glioma is a tumor of glial cells, but not all gliomas behave the same way. Some are lower grade and grow more slowly, while others are higher grade and more aggressive. A doctor uses pathology and molecular testing to define the exact diagnosis.
What is the difference between glioma and glioblastoma?
Glioma is a broad category that includes several types of tumors arising from glial cells. Glioblastoma is one specific, high-grade type of glioma. In other words, all glioblastomas are gliomas, but not all gliomas are glioblastomas.
Can an MRI alone diagnose glioma?
MRI is very important and often strongly suggests a glioma, but it usually cannot provide the full diagnosis by itself. In most cases, doctors need a biopsy or surgical tissue sample to confirm the tumor type and perform molecular testing. This information is essential for treatment planning.
What treatments are commonly used for glioma?
Common treatments include surgery, radiation therapy, and chemotherapy, used alone or in combination. The choice depends on the tumor's grade, location, and molecular features, as well as the patient's overall health. Some lower-grade gliomas may be monitored for a period after surgery.
How is the outlook for glioma determined?
Doctors consider several factors, including the person's age, symptoms, tumor grade, location, extent of surgical removal, and molecular test results. These details help estimate how the tumor may behave and how well it may respond to treatment. Outlook is individualized and best discussed with the treating specialist.
Can people live for years with glioma?
Yes, some people, especially those with lower-grade gliomas or favorable molecular features, may live with the condition for many years. Others may need more intensive treatment and closer follow-up because their tumor is more aggressive. Regular monitoring helps guide care over time.
